CONCACAF has a different rule for its CONCACAF Champions League, employing away goals at the end of full time of the second leg, but not applying the rule at the end of extra time. For example, the semifinal of the 2008–09 CONCACAF Champions League between Cruz Azul and the Puerto Rico Islanders had the following scorelines:
First leg: Puerto Rico Islanders 2 – 0 Cruz Azul
Second leg, after 90 minutes: Cruz Azul 2 – 0 Puerto Rico Islanders
Second leg, after extra time: Cruz Azul 3 – 1 Puerto Rico Islanders
Under UEFA rules, the Puerto Rico Islanders would have advanced. However, because CONCACAF does not apply the away goals rule a second time, the tie went to a shootout, which Cruz Azul won 4–2.
